Balance. Cooperation between all the lights brings the complete repair.
Balance = cooperation among lights. Each light carries out its repairs while taking the others into account. One cycle leads to general perfection — only good with no further evil.
Op. 69 closes the World of Repair unit with the unit's culminating principle. The matkela — the balance — is cooperation. Each light's repair-portion is calibrated to the other lights' contributions; the cosmic government's complete repair emerges from this cooperative coordination. The chapter is brief but doctrinally definitive.
A single light, doing its repair-work in isolation, would not produce the cosmic-government's complete repair. The repair requires cooperation — each light taking the others into account as it does its work. The cosmic government, in its complete form, is a coordinated operation, not a sum of independent contributions.
This is why the cosmic-anatomical structure Klach has been describing is not arbitrary. The Sefirot, the Partzufim, the kinship-architecture, the Coupling-Pregnancy-Birth-Suckling cycle — all of this is the operational form of the cooperation Op. 69 names. Each structure exists for the sake of the coordination it makes possible.
One cycle leads to general perfection. The cycle of creation, when complete, produces a state of only good with no further evil. This is the Op. 49 return-to-good doctrine in its most concentrated form. The Other Side, after the cycle, reverts to good; evil, having served its operational purpose, is no longer needed; only the rule of unity remains.
